Strategic Search & Filtering for Gaming Laptop eBay Listings

How do you cut through the noise of millions of listings to find that perfect gaming laptop deal? The key lies in mastering eBay's advanced search and filtering tools. Simply typing "gaming laptop eBay" will yield overwhelming results, many of which won't meet your criteria. Your goal is to narrow down your options to a manageable, high-quality selection.

Start by using specific keywords. Instead of just "gaming laptop," try "RTX 3070 gaming laptop" or "Ryzen 7 gaming laptop 144Hz." Combine brand names with specifications, like "ASUS ROG Strix RTX 3060." This precision immediately weeds out irrelevant items. Next, delve into eBay's powerful filtering options. These are your best friends for resource allocation efficiency.

Applying Advanced Filters for Precision

eBay offers a robust set of filters that can drastically refine your search. Don't overlook them:

  1. Condition: "New," "Open Box," "Manufacturer Refurbished," "Seller Refurbished," and "Used." For gaming laptops, "Manufacturer Refurbished" often offers excellent value with warranties. "Used" can be great but requires more scrutiny.
  2. Price Range: Set your minimum and maximum budget to eliminate listings outside your financial scope.
  3. Location: Filter by seller location to reduce shipping times and costs, especially for international buyers (e.g., avoiding French eBay if you're in the US due to shipping complications).
  4. Brand: Select preferred brands like Alienware, Razer, MSI, ASUS, or Lenovo.
  5. Processor Type & Speed: Specify Intel Core i7/i9 or AMD Ryzen 7/9 and desired clock speeds.
  6. Graphics Processor: This is crucial. Filter by NVIDIA GeForce RTX series (e.g., 3060, 3070, 4080) or AMD Radeon RX series.
  7. RAM & Storage: Minimum 16GB RAM is advisable for modern gaming; filter for SSD storage (NVMe preferred) with adequate capacity.
  8. Screen Size & Resolution: Choose your preferred display dimensions and resolution (1080p, 1440p) and refresh rate (120Hz, 144Hz, 240Hz).

Evaluating Sellers and Listing Quality on eBay Gaming Laptop Listings

Once you've filtered your search, the next critical step is rigorously evaluating both the seller and the specific listing. This is where many buyers make mistakes, leading to disappointment. A low price is only a good deal if the item and seller are trustworthy.

Seller Vetting: Your First Line of Defense

Before you even look closely at the laptop, scrutinize the seller's profile. Here's what to look for:

  • Feedback Score: Aim for sellers with 98% positive feedback or higher, especially for high-value items like gaming laptops. A high volume of feedback (hundreds or thousands) with a high percentage is ideal.
  • Feedback History: Click on the feedback score to read recent reviews. Look for comments specifically about electronics or similar high-value items. Are there complaints about item condition, shipping, or communication?
  • Seller Type: Differentiate between private sellers and business sellers. Business sellers often offer more robust return policies and sometimes even warranties.
  • Activity & Specialization: Does the seller frequently sell electronics, or is this a one-off listing? Specialized sellers are generally more knowledgeable and reliable. Deep-Diving into the Listing Description and Photos

This is where you unlock tangible value through meticulous examination. A comprehensive listing is a good sign; vague descriptions are a red flag.

  • Detailed Description: Read every word. Does it clearly state the laptop's exact model number, specifications (CPU, GPU, RAM, storage, screen type, battery health), and any known defects? Look for phrases like "boots to BIOS only" or "missing keycaps."
  • Condition: Does the description align with the condition selected in the filters? "Used" can mean anything from minor scuffs to significant damage.
  • Photos: Are there multiple high-resolution photos taken from various angles? Do they clearly show the screen, keyboard, ports, and any cosmetic imperfections? Request more photos if necessary. Generic stock photos are a huge red flag; insist on actual product images.
  • Included Accessories: Does it come with the original charger, box, and any other accessories? Missing chargers can be expensive to replace.
  • Return Policy: Does the seller accept returns? What are the conditions? eBay's Money Back Guarantee offers some protection, but a seller's explicit return policy adds another layer of security.
  • Shipping Details: What's the shipping cost and method? Is it insured? International shipping can be complex, impacting total cost and delivery time.

Price Comparison & Bid Strategy for Your eBay Gaming Laptop

You've found a promising gaming laptop, vetted the seller, and scrutinized the listing. Now, how do you ensure you're paying a fair price and winning the auction or making a smart 'Buy It Now' purchase? This stage requires strategic implementation guidelines and a keen eye on market value.

Establishing Fair Market Value

Don't assume an eBay price is automatically a good deal. Research is paramount:

  • Completed Listings: Search eBay's "Sold Listings" for the exact same model. This shows what similar laptops have actually sold for recently. Filter by condition and specifications.
  • New Retail Prices: Check major retailers (Amazon, Best Buy, manufacturer websites) for the price of the laptop new, or the closest current model. This provides an upper bound for your budget.
  • Other Used Marketplaces: Briefly check sites like Facebook Marketplace, Swappa, or local classifieds for general price trends, though eBay's sold listings are typically the most reliable benchmark for its own ecosystem.

By comparing these sources, you can establish a realistic price range for the laptop you're targeting. This impact assessment metric ensures you avoid overpaying.

Auction vs. Buy It Now: Maximizing Savings

eBay offers two primary purchasing methods, each with its own strategy:

FeatureAuction StrategyBuy It Now Strategy
OpportunityPotential for lower price if less competition.Guaranteed purchase, often at market value.
RiskCan escalate with bidding wars, or be outbid.May pay slightly more than a lucky auction win.
Best UseFor items with limited current demand or ending at odd hours.When you need the item immediately or found a stellar fixed-price deal.
Key TacticSet a maximum bid and use a sniping tool or bid in the final seconds.Compare fixed price to market value; make a reasonable offer if available.

For auctions, avoid early bidding wars. This only drives up the price. Instead, determine your absolute maximum bid based on your market research and enter it in the final seconds of the auction using a 'bid sniping' approach. This doesn't guarantee a win, but it prevents emotional overbidding.

When making an offer on a 'Buy It Now' listing, always include a polite, concise message referencing your research, e.g., "I've seen similar models sell for X amount; would you accept Y?" This professional approach can increase your chances of a successful negotiation.

Inspection Upon Arrival

When your gaming laptop arrives, perform a thorough inspection immediately. Do not wait days or weeks.

  1. Packaging: Check for any external damage to the box. Photograph it if damaged.
  2. Cosmetic Condition: Compare the laptop's appearance against the listing photos and description. Note any new scratches, dents, or wear not previously disclosed.
  3. Functionality Test:
    • Power On: Does it boot up correctly?
    • Screen: Check for dead pixels, backlight bleed, or lines.
    • Keyboard/Touchpad: Test every key and the touchpad's responsiveness.
    • Ports: Test all USB, HDMI, Ethernet, and audio ports with peripherals.
    • Wi-Fi/Bluetooth: Confirm connectivity.
    • Speakers/Microphone: Test audio input and output.
    • Battery: Check battery health (often visible in Windows settings or dedicated software).
    • Stress Test: Run a benchmark or a demanding game for a short period to check for overheating or performance issues under load.
  4. Specifications Verification: Confirm the CPU, GPU, RAM, and storage match the listing using system information tools (e.g., Windows Task Manager, GPU-Z, CPU-Z).

If anything is not as described or damaged, document it with clear photos and videos. This is a critical impact assessment metric, allowing you to promptly address any discrepancies.

Resolving Issues: eBay's Money Back Guarantee

If there's a problem, act quickly. Contact the seller first to see if you can resolve it amicably. If not, open a case with eBay's Money Back Guarantee within the specified timeframe (usually 30 days from delivery). eBay will mediate and often rule in favor of the buyer if the item is significantly not as described. Utilizing Watchlists and Saved Searches

Don't just search once. Create saved searches for your desired gaming laptop specifications. eBay will then email you daily or weekly with new listings that match your criteria. This keeps you informed without constantly checking the site. Add promising listings to your watchlist to monitor their progress, especially auctions. This is a key process optimization strategy, ensuring you don't miss out on emerging opportunities.

Exploring "Make Offer" Options

Many "Buy It Now" listings include a "Make Offer" button. Don't be afraid to use it! Sellers often price with a little wiggle room. Start with an offer slightly below what you're willing to pay, leaving room for negotiation. A reasonable offer, even if it's 10-15% below asking, can often be accepted, securing a better price than you initially anticipated. Consider the digital efficiencies gained by simply asking.

Spotting Misspellings and Niche Keywords

Sometimes, sellers make typos in their titles or descriptions. Listings with misspellings (e.g., "gmaing laptop," "gamming lap top") might receive fewer bids because they don't appear in standard searches. Tools exist online that help you find these misspelled listings. Similarly, searching for very niche or obscure model numbers can sometimes reveal underpriced items that broader searches miss. Timing Your Bids and Purchases

Auctions ending during off-peak hours (e.g., late night on a weekday, early morning) often attract fewer bidders, leading to lower final prices. If you're flexible, target these times. For "Buy It Now" listings, keep an eye out for seller promotions or holiday sales, though these are less common for individual sellers.
